Stocks are riding an earnings hot streak - but investors are facing a summer that rife with risks
U.S. stocks hit record levels heading into Memorial Day, but MarketWatch cites risks for the summer: accelerating inflation that could lift bond yields, and a heavy IPO pipeline that may pull liquidity from existing shares. SpaceX’s SEC filing (reported potential $80B+) and OpenAI’s planned September IPO are highlighted. Oil inventories are falling fast; WTI is about $96.60 and gasoline averages $4.552.
